i actually just made a new thread with the norwegian 2.2 zip flashable update, some reports of touchscreen responsiveness differences, faster gps fix, figure let anybody play with it that wants it without losing clockwork, the additions made to the norwegian version will be incorporated into the indonesian version VERY soon, i noticed on the Norwegian for some reason the data partition is 163MB and is already filled up a bit leaving 105mb to play with, which is not enough for even apps2sd to work effeciently.

personally i like the indonesian one better. Which 1.1 will be released sometime today probably, whenever i finish compiling an AOSP kernel for our device (cross fingers), so i can see if we can get stock aosp rom on here....

nice work joenilan !

I flashed your Indonesian version Stable 1.0 yesterday and it seemed to work fine. Also flashed the Norwegian 1.1 and finally the Indonesian Stable 1.1 and will stay with it, hopefully.

here are some instructions / details in case people have difficulties (like me) remembering all these tools:
( Clockwork Mode must already be installed)

1) make sure Menu>Setting>Application>Development>USB Debugging : OFF
2) connect PC and tablet by USB cable, on the tablet choose "USB Storage Mode"; the internal SD will be accessible as one of the PCs removable drive.
3) copy the 'Ideos_S7_Froyo_v1.1-INDO.zip' file ( as downloaded do NOT unzip ! ) to the internal SD card
4) then, on the PC start Easeus Partition Manager and find the new drive, right-click on it, select 'resize' and reduce to 600 MB,
a 2nd unpartitioned space will appear, right-click on it, select 'create';
a new window will open; choose 'ext2' as format and take all the free space; click 'apply', Easeus will now realize the changes to the internal SD
5) now set
Menu>Setting>Application>Development>USB Debugging : ON
6) start Ideos_S7_tool, enter 'R' to boot up the tablet in Clockwork Mode
or boot into Recovery thru "Quick Boot" app

in Clockwork Mode there are 5 keys for navigating the menus:

vol+ : up
vol- : down
-on the right side of the tablet
green key: select
red key = On/Off = Back: back

6) do the 'wipe data/factory reset' and 'wipe cache', each takes only a few seconds
7) then 'install zip from sdcard'
take option 'choose zip from sdcard' and select the 'Ideos_S7_Froyo_v1.1-INDO.zip' file
8) once the update is done, 'reboot system now'

the tablet will come up once and reboot again by itself after a few seconds,
after the second boot you can start to set it up & use it.
